返回列表 上一主題 發帖

設定VBA CommandButton切換隱藏列修改為隱藏欄

設定VBA CommandButton切換隱藏列修改為隱藏欄

各位新進請教一下我使用下列語法執行CommandButton控制隱藏了8~15列
如我要修改成CommandButton1隱藏E~H及CommandButton2 隱藏 N~S
請問該語法該如何修正

Private Sub CommandButton1_Click()
    With Rows("8:15")
        .EntireRow.Hidden = IIf(.EntireRow.Hidden, False, True)
    Dim Msg As Boolean
     End With
    With CommandButton1
        .Caption = IIf(Msg, "顯示", "隱藏")
        .BackColor = IIf(Msg, vbRed, vbBlue)
        .ForeColor = IIf(Msg, vbBlack, vbWhite)
    End With
    End Sub

回復 1# james1912
許多程式碼可用錄製新巨集取得.
練習一下操作欄的隱藏程式碼,帶入你的程式碼試試看.
感恩的心......(在麻辣家族討論區.用心學習會有進步的)
但資源無限,後援有限,  一天1元的贊助,人人有能力.

TOP

回復 2# GBKEE


    感謝您!我已研究出來了

TOP

        靜思自在 : 君子立恆志,小人恆立志。
返回列表 上一主題